Safety and Efficacy of Intravenous Immunoglobulin IgPro10 in Patients With Primary Immunodeficiencies (PID)

A Multicenter Extension Study on the Safety and Efficacy of IgPro10 in Patients With Primary Immunodeficiency (PID)

Brief summary

The objectives of this trial are the assessment of safety and efficacy of IgPro10 in patients with PID, and the assessment of tolerability of high infusion rates. To demonstrate safety, the number of infusions temporally associated with AEs, the rate, severity and relationship of all AEs and the vital sign changes during each infusion will be evaluated.

Interventions

Liquid formulation; treatment schedule every 3 or 4 weeks using an individualized regimen with a dose of 0.2 - 0.8 g IgG per kg bw

Inclusion criteria

Key Inclusion Criteria: Patients with CVID (Common Variable Immunodeficiency) or XLA (X-linked agammaglobulinemia) who: Participated in the Phase III clinical study with intravenous IgPro10 (study number ZLB03\_002CR) at 3- or 4- weekly intervals for 12 months (referred to as 'old' subjects) OR Were ≥ 6 years of age, were on other stable intravenous immunoglobulin therapy (200-800 mg IgG per kg body weight) at 3- or 4-week intervals for at least 6 months, AND were interested in participating in the Phase III clinical study with subcutaneous IgPro20 (study number ZLB04\_009CR) (referred to as 'new' subjects) Written informed consent Key

Exclusion criteria

Diagnosis of epilepsia Insulin dependent diabetes Administration of steroids (daily ≥ 0.15 mg prednisone equivalent/kg/day) or other immunosuppressive drugs History of cardiac insufficiency (NYHA III/IV), cardiomyopathy, congestive heart failure, severe hypertension

Secondary

Annualized Rate of Acute Serious Bacterial Infections.

The annualized rate was based on the total number of infections and the total number of subject study days for all subjects in the specified analysis population and adjusted to 365 days. Acute serious bacterial infections included pneumonia, bacteremia / septicemia, osteomyelitis / septic arthritis, bacterial meningitis, and visceral abscess.

Time frame: For the duration of the study, up to approximately 29 months

Population: The Intention-To-Treat (ITT) data set comprised all subjects treated with the study drug

ArmMeasureValue (NUMBER)
IgPro10Annualized Rate of Acute Serious Bacterial Infections.0.018 Infections per subject year

Secondary

Trough Levels of Total Immunoglobulin (IgG) Serum Concentrations.

Mean IgG trough concentration. For this analysis, each subject's values were first aggregated to their median and the median values were then analyzed.

Time frame: Prior to each infusion; every 3 or 4 weeks depending upon the dosing schedule.

Population: The ITT data set comprised all subjects treated with the study drug for which serum IgG information was available.

ArmMeasureValue (MEAN)
IgPro10Trough Levels of Total Immunoglobulin (IgG) Serum Concentrations.9.72 g/L
